The Questioning of Muon Quark

It wasn't a job he liked, questioning fellow officers. But there was a reason they'd asked him to do this; his old ties to the name Aegis, his years in security, his current responsibilities as chief of tactical operations in the nearby Canar sector, his empathic and telepathic abilities, and his experience dealing with civilian and Starfleet interactions. D'Mysus looked at Commander Muon and proceeded with his job.

 

"Who gave the order to hold the Gorn ship?"

 

Muon hesitated before answering. "Commander Hawke." She replied tightly.

 

"And where was Hawke when she gave the order?"

 

 

A frown crossed Muon's lips. "She was in sickbay with Captain Ayers. It was right after he had been attacked by the Rixian."

 

 

Continuing quickly along, "Where were you?"

 

"I was searching the Captain's quarters with JoNs and then I went down to sickbay to ensure the Rixian was secure, see how the Captain and Ethan was doing, and to question Ethan about the attack. The Captain was unconcious at the time."

 

"Who gave the order to beam the Gorn crew off their ship?"

 

 

Tightly and with another hesitation, "Hawke."

 

 

"Did Ambassador Joy, DURING the events, inform anyone of the diplomatic and legal consequences of these actions?"

 

Muon raises an eyebrow as if a new thought had occurred to her: "No. I don't believe so. As a matter of fact, after the incident I had to kick that Mudd Ambassador off the CT. She was snooping around, looking for information."

 

"I will be wanting to ask her some questions as well." Commander Ramson relaxed back in his chair. "Too much happened too quickly and I think some judgements were come to just as quickly." D'Mysus stood. "I thank you for your information, I won't tell Drankum you didn't charge me for it." With a wink he turned back towards the door.

 

Muon let out a snort. "Don't try to get on my good side Commander."

 

 

Stopping just before the doorway the Commander turned his head. "One last question, How much warning did the Admiral and Captain give of the incoming presence of so many diplomats? Was ANY diplomatic training or refresher courses even offered?"

 

 

Muon sighed tiredly. "We hardly had anytime to prepare and no, no refresher training or courses. You have to understand that Aegis has recently become more of a diplomatic hub rather than a military presense. We all, meaning the command staff, should have remembered to have diplomatic training and some refresher courses."

 

"I see." Ramson turned and looked down in thought. Without saying anything else D'Mysus continued out the door.
